TEACHING PRACTICE WEEK 1 REFLECTION
GVHSS, Vadakkadathucavu was a learning hub for
all of us to practice the theoretical aspect of teaching acquired in the B.Ed
classes. We, as a team consisting of seven members started our teaching
practice of semester 3, on 14 November 2022. First day itself we could be a
part of the celebrations of Children's day 2022. As the school has traditional
outward look, it has the magical power to take its visitors back to their
childhood memories. The school contains LP, UP and H.S Sections. Each class has
only one division and as a result both Malayalam and English medium students
learn together. Teachers provided us with the time table and we were given one
period for every day. Each period consists of 30-35 minutes. We felt it as a
short time span to complete one lesson plan within one period.
In the first day Students responded well but
as it was the first class, I found difficulty in controlling some of the
students. But as the days continued, I could manage the class well and students
slowly got adjusted to my teaching method.
Day two of our school training period was
happened on Tuesday, 17th Nov 2022. Due to KSU All Kerala Education
Strike, after the prayer students were asked to leave the school. Being a part
of teaching community, we were asked to stay back to participate in the
discussion forum new curriculum development in Kerala. The discussion session
started at 2 pm. PTA president, ward members, panchayath president, development
standing committee chairman all were part of the forum. Retired teachers were
also participated in the function. The discussion lasted till 4:30 pm. Even
though, there was no class on this day, we were happy that we could be a part
of new Kerala Curriculum Framework forum.
